Hideaway Hair Salon occupies a suite on the Temecula Parkway retail strip, operating as a general-service salon handling cuts, color, and styling for adults and children. The work spans straightforward trims to multi-session color projects, with the salon structured around a traditional appointment model rather than walk-in availability. This format shapes the pace: clients book ahead, arrive at a set time, and move through their service without the rapid-turnover feel of a high-volume chain. The clientele splits between regulars maintaining color on a six-to-eight-week cycle, parents bringing kids in for routine cuts, and clients booking longer sessions for significant color work or event preparation. For someone seeking a specific stylist or preferring scheduled time rather than waiting in a lobby, the appointment structure suits that pattern. For a quick blowout between errands or a walk-in fade, faster-turnaround shops elsewhere on the Parkway would be a better fit. The salon functions as a place where an established client-stylist relationship can develop over repeated visits.

Healthy Hair Salon and Head Spa by Revyvl operates on 6th Street in Old Town Temecula as a hybrid salon and wellness space, blending traditional hair services with scalp treatments and head massage — a format that sets it apart from the standard cut-and-color chair rotation. The salon model centers on appointment booking rather than walk-in traffic, suited to clients who book ahead and plan their visit around a multi-service experience rather than a quick trim. The typical client books for color work paired with a scalp or head treatment, or returns on a six-to-eight-week maintenance cycle for refresh appointments. The setup works for regulars who've established a relationship with their stylist and know the pacing of their own hair cycle, and for clients treating a salon visit as part of a broader self-care routine rather than pure grooming errand. The Old Town location pulls from the neighborhood's foot traffic and resident base; the appointment model means capacity is set by the schedule, not walk-in volume. This suits clients who prefer knowing exactly when their chair is ready and what they're paying for, rather than the variable timing of a busier salon floor.

Salon on 3rd sits on 3rd Street in Old Town Temecula, positioned within the walkable cluster of salons and service shops that make the historic downtown a practical stop for regular maintenance. Anel Sarai operates here as a color specialist, focusing on dimensional work rather than the broad cut-and-color model—the kind of stylist clients book four to eight weeks out and commit to for continuity as their color evolves. This format suits clients building a relationship with one stylist over time, regulars who know what they want and return on a predictable cycle, and anyone planning a significant color change that benefits from a multi-visit strategy. For a quick men's trim or a child's first haircut, other salons in town match that pace better. For someone wanting consistent dimensional color work in a setting where the stylist remembers their previous sessions and color history, the appointment-based model at this location makes sense—Old Town's walkability doesn't hurt either, since a longer color session pairs easily with a nearby coffee or retail stop while the work finishes.

What Locals Know
Old Town Temecula salons rely heavily on appointment density and consistent clientele — walk-in traffic is lighter here than at freeway-adjacent locations, so regulars with standing bookings typically secure preferred time slots while casual visitors may face longer waits.
